This new tap is very useful for me. I just haven't had the time to write it. Thanks to Martin.

However I attached patches for the sip, http, wap-wsp and the bootp tap. These patches remove a lot of redundant code by using the generic filter dialog for gui taps.

The generic filter dialog introduces additionally some improvements to these taps: A button to the dialog with saved display filters and red/green colouring of bad/good filter syntax.

Is it bad form not to supply a corresponding tap-sip.c (for tethereal
presumably, which I seldom use) ?

I will supply one based on yours soon.



It might be nice to supply one - but, ultimately, we should have a
mechanism by which you can have a tap present a table without *any* GUI
code being written, and by which the same tap code could work in Tethereal
and Ethereal; the tap code would just construct the statistics and
register them, and code in Ethereal would take responsibility for
displaying the table and code in Tethereal would take responsibility for
printing it.


Well I did a little work on this. I already created a very small and simple api. I was able to change and compile a simple tap (the h225 message and reason counter) with identical source code for ethereal and tethereal. If someone is interested I will mail to the list what I have done so far.
